Bodrum

Bodrum is often regarded as the jewel of the Aegean Sea. Known for its vibrant nightlife, historical sites, and stunning beaches, Bodrum is a must-visit for yacht enthusiasts. The Bodrum Marina is one of the best-equipped ports in the region, offering various services. While in Bodrum, don’t miss exploring the ancient Bodrum Castle and the Underwater Archaeology Museum.

Marmaris

Marmaris is not only a beautiful coastal town but also a bustling yacht haven. It features a well-protected harbor and a lively promenade lined with restaurants and bars. The surrounding areas offer numerous coves and bays perfect for anchoring. For those seeking adventure, the nearby Rhodes in Greece is a short sail away, making it an ideal day trip.

Fethiye

Fethiye is famous for its breathtaking scenery and rich history. The Fethiye Gulf is dotted with serene bays like Ölüdeniz, known for its stunning blue lagoon. Yacht visitors can explore the ancient ruins of Telmessos and the famous rock tombs, which are carved into the cliffs. For an unforgettable experience, consider taking a blue cruise through the 12 Islands of Fethiye.

Kaş

Kaş is a lesser-known gem that offers a more tranquil sailing experience. With its charming streets, friendly atmosphere, and clear waters, Kaş attracts those seeking relaxation. Dive into the rich underwater life or anchor in the uninhabited islands nearby, like Kekova, famous for its sunken city ruins. The local taverns offer a taste of the delicious Mediterranean cuisine that will delight your palate.

Antalya

Antalya is a larger city that combines modern amenities with ancient history. Its old town, Kaleiçi, is brimming with narrow streets and old architecture, providing an exciting backdrop after a day at sea. Marina options abound, and from here, you can explore the beautiful nearby coves or sail further to the stunning Düden Waterfalls. Many yacht charters also offer the chance to visit the nearby Greek island of Meis.

Göcek

Göcek is often considered one of Turkey's top yacht destinations. Known for its calm waters and natural beauty, it serves as a hub for blue cruises. With several marinas and anchorages, you can easily access the stunning bays around the area. Visit the nearby Butterfly Valley and enjoy hiking, swimming, or simply soaking in the natural beauty. Göcek’s charming village also offers delightful restaurants for an evening meal.

Datça

The Datça Peninsula is famous for its unspoiled beauty and tranquil atmosphere. With countless bays and coves, it provides an idyllic setting for sailors who enjoy exploring off the beaten path. Visit Knidos, an ancient city with magnificent ruins overlooking the sea, or simply enjoy the peaceful beaches that the region offers.
